New Principal for La Ballona Elementary School

 

Luis Ramirez

Luis Ramirez will be the new Principal of La Ballona Elementary School.

The announcement by CCUSD also named Vanessa San Martin as CCUSD'S Director of Child Development.

Both appointments were approved unanimously by the CCUSD Board of Education on May 22. Ms. San Martin starts effective June 4; Mr. Ramirez begins effective July 24.

"Both Vanessa and Luis bring a wealth of experience and expertise to their positions. We are pleased to welcome them to the CCUSD family and look forward to the positive impact they will have on their school's students, parents and staff," said Superintendent Leslie Lockhart.

Mr. Ramirez spent 15 of his almost 30 years as an educator in Santa Monica Malibu Unified School District. He worked as dual language classroom teacher/Co-coordinator at John Adams Middle School, a high school advisor at Santa Monica high school, and an Assistant Principal at Grant Elementary and John Adams Middle School.

In South Los Angeles he opened a new public charter middle school for the Alliance for College Ready Public Schools. During his five years as founding principal, he grew the school's population from 97 students and five teachers to 460 students in grades 6-8, and a staff of more than 30 teachers and employees.

When Mr. Ramirez realized he missed the challenges of working within a unified school district, it led to his former position as Principal of Norma Harrington Elementary School, a STEAM school in the Oxnard School District. He supported Focus on the Masters, where students were introduced to local artists. He extended music for the lower grades, creating a music rotation for grades 2-5. He diligent worked with ELAC, PTA and a district survey to support parenting classes that focused on academics, and social emotional aspect of parenting. His school was one of three schools to increase in both ELA and Math based on the California Dashboard within the Oxnard School District. He has a degree in Mexican-American (Chicano) Studies and a master's degree in Educational Administration from California State University Northridge.

Ms. San Martin has worked with children, parents, staff, and nutritional services for over 14 years. She has extensive experience in High Scope curriculum, a comprehensive educational approach that emphasizes "active participatory learning."

Before joining CCUSD, Ms. San Martin served as an Early Education and Extended Program Supervisor at Glendale Unified School District, overseeing all preschool centers and seven school age centers. This included State Pre-School, Special Education Preschool, School Age Program, General Child Care, Recreational Afterschool Program and the Infant/Toddler Programs. She was instrumental in implementing the PBIS (Positive Behavior Intervention and Support) and was credited with enhancing relationships between her department and special education by facilitating results-oriented meetings. Her experience includes the critical components of licensing, compliance, implementing best practices and proactively leading thought-provoking professional development sessions for her staff. Ms. Vanessa San Martin received both her bachelor's and master's degrees in Child Development/Early Childhood from University of La Verne.

"We are happy to welcome Ms. San Martin to the CCUSD Family of Schools and look forward to her sharing her passion and expertise in Early Childhood Education with us," said Jennifer Slabbinck, CCUSD's Assistant Superintendent, Human Resources.
